ABC Analysis Framework
Though many stock management options are practiced, the ABC Analysis Strategy rises above as a powerful tool for maximizing warehouse efficiency. This system categorizes inventory into three levels: A, B, and C. 'A' items constitute the top value but the least quantity, required close tracking and management. 'B' items are of balanced value and quantity, while 'C' items have the lowest value and the maximum quantity, permitting for easier oversight. By focusing efforts according to these categories, enterprises can allocate time and attention more effectively, assuring that critical items remain in stock while minimizing excess inventory. This strategic approach leads to reduced carrying costs and heightened overall operational efficiency, making it essential for effective warehouse management.
Cycle Counting Advantages
Cycle counting emerges as a essential inventory management practice that significantly enhances warehouse efficiency. This method involves frequently tallying a subset of inventory items, allowing businesses to maintain accurate stock records without the disruption of full inventory audits. By identifying discrepancies in real-time, companies can resolve issues promptly, reducing the likelihood of stockouts or overstock situations. Additionally, cycle counting promotes accountability among staff, fostering a culture of accuracy and responsibility. It also optimizes operations, as employees can focus on smaller, manageable counts rather than overwhelming inventory assessments. Ultimately, cycle counting not only enhances inventory accuracy but also optimizes resource allocation, leading to cost savings and enhanced overall productivity in warehouse management.

Productive Warehouse Layout Strategies for Space Enhancement
Optimizing storage area is vital for maximizing efficiency and productivity, as a well-planned layout can greatly improve operational flow. Effective warehouse layout strategies involve several key principles. First, the use of a grid system can facilitate organized storage, allowing for simple navigation and retrieval. Second, implementing a zone-based layout guarantees that commonly used items are positioned closer to shipping areas, reducing travel time for staff.
Vertical space utilization is another important aspect; using racking and shelving units can considerably enhance storage capacity without extending the warehouse footprint. Additionally, clear directions and established pathways can better safety and streamline operations.
Integrating digital tools, such as warehouse management systems, aids in monitoring inventory and improving space allocation. By applying these strategies, businesses can establish a more streamlined warehouse environment, ultimately resulting in increased productivity and reduced operational costs.
